Inside Out

She was two people, two very different people, trapped in one body. There was Rebecca Pope, for starters. A married mother who survived the ferry crash with a crushed face. Out of that wreckage came Ava. A woman who was in love with her doctor and would do anything to be able to stay with him.

She was two very, very different people trapped in the same body. Ava, or was it Rebecca, lay silently on the bed in the hospital. Crazy. That's what she was. She had multiple personalities, but they didn't understand. It wasn't just personalities. It was body, heart, soul, and minds. Not one single thing was the same. They were different, both inside and out.
